Luxenhaus Day Spa Opens in Franklin

Luxenhaus Day Spa has opened in Franklin at 1175 Meridian Blvd, in the former location of Woodhouse Day Spa.

This will be a second location for Luxenhaus, the spa also acquired the Chattanooga location reported Chattanooga Times Free Press. 

Owned by Calina Burns, the spa name is a reference to her German ancestry. The name Luxenhaus gives recognition to both sides of European history.

“I was born in Germany and haus is German for house,” Burns told Chattanooga Times Free Press. “My ancestry also goes back to the Basque area of Western Europe, which includes parts of Spain and France. The literal translation for luxen, which comes from this region, is “in luxury.”

Customers will find an extensive list of treatments, massages, and packages just like what was previously offered at Woodhouse.

Luxenhaus will honor gift cards purchased at Woodhouse Day Spa, the customer just needs to call or stop by the spa to exchange them for a Luxenhaus Spa card.
